ATTEMPTED MURDER SUSPECT FOUND DEAD FROM SELF INFLICTED GUNSHOT WOUND

news picture
December 1, 2023

Greenwood, DE - In a coordinated effort with allied law enforcement agencies, Delaware State Police located Brian Holben, the attempted murder suspect involved in the officer-involved shooting, on Tuesday. The culmination of investigative efforts led to the execution of a search warrant on Thursday afternoon, resulting in the discovery of Holben's deceased body in Maryland.

On Thursday, November 30, 2023, at approximately 4:00 p.m., Maryland State Police, in collaboration with the U.S. Marshal's Task Force, assisted Delaware State Police detectives by serving a search warrant for Holben. The operation aimed to apprehend Holben, who had fired a gun at Delaware State Police detectives on November 28, 2023. Through investigative means, detectives learned of Holben's location inside a camper situated on the property.

During the execution of the search warrant, it was confirmed that Holben was inside the camper. Despite attempts to get him to surrender, Holben barricaded himself inside. Subsequent efforts to negotiate his surrender were unsuccessful. When police entered the camper, they discovered Holben with an apparent self-inflicted gunshot wound. He was pronounced dead at the scene.
